Responsibilities:
Provide sales process support to client teams, leadership, other internal operations teams and interfacing functional areas. Assist Accenture Practitioners in navigating the company's internal sales processes. Support S&PP Leadership and Business Partners in driving efforts across multiple S&PP service areas.
Critical services include the support of opportunity pipeline management, new business meeting coordination, sales reporting/analysis for leadership, and internal sales processes/tools support for client teams.
This position reports to Sales & Pricing Performance Sales Operations Leadership, Senior Managers, Managers, Associate Managers, or Specialists. Note that depending on your specific responsibilities you may also be aligned to and take direction from business leadership role(s).
